Key Responsibilities
- The key responsibilities of this role are:
- Acts as a primary contact for Intake Specialists to assist with all incoming requests for the National DocPro team
- Ensures appropriate coordination of the Intake Specialists, ensuring a strong focus on service delivery and excellence
- Coordinates the staffing resources available to ensure adequate coverage and the most effective use of the team members
- Acts as a team player within the Intake team with overflow, urgent deadlines and back-up coverage
- Monitors the centralized inbox and updates requests with any changing priorities, and keep requestors informed on the progress of their work
- Monitors Intake Specialists overall performance to ensure competency levels are met and new skills acquired, if necessary
- Participates in onboarding, training and development of new Intake Specialists
- Works closely with the Team Leads and Manager, DocPro Centre to manage volume, assess coverage needs and determine allocation of resources for the highest-priority requests
- Remains attentive to the team’s fluctuating capacity demands in order to appropriately communicate accurate deadlines with requestors
- Collaborates with Team Leads and Manager, DocPro Centre to develop workflow processes and leverage technology to optimize the workflow management
- Provides all clients with professional and exceptional client service
- Assists with DocPro team related projects as assigned
- Keeps up-to-date on changes in practice and procedural requirements

Key Competencies
- Previous leadership experience, working within a law firm an asset
- Working knowledge of legal documents terms and litigation procedures, an asset
- Advanced knowledge of MS Office products
- Bilingualism (French and English), spoken and written, an asset
- Excellent organizational and time management skills to effectively prioritize and meet deadlines with mínimal supervision
-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to work well independently and collaboratively within a team environment
- Excellent communication skills (verbal and written) with the ability to interact with individuals at all levels within the organization
- Strong leadership skills with the ability to lead by example
- Strong customer focus and experience in client service/ professional services environment
- Ability to adapt and learn new technology
